London, 23 June 2025. The IU Group, one of Europe’s largest university groups, has been awarded the prestigious EdTechX Leviathan Award for the third consecutive year.
The EdTechX Leviathan Award recognises established, high-growth companies that are shaping the future of digital education and workforce development. IU Group once again impressed the jury with its global expansion, innovative use of technology, and unwavering commitment to delivering truly personalised education experiences.
“This award reinforces our mission to make high-quality education accessible to all,” said Dr Sven Schütt, CEO of IU Group. “It’s a powerful acknowledgement of the impact our team is making worldwide. We remain focused on innovation and inclusion — empowering learners everywhere to reach their full potential.”
The award was presented during the EdTechX Awards ceremony in London to Dr Marian Bodenstedt (COO Online DACH), Stephan Schäfer (Director Pre-Sales OnCampus), and Edward Harland-Lang (Head of Growth, Walbrook Institute London). The physical award is now displayed at the Walbrook Institute London, IU Group’s UK-based subsidiary, as a symbol of IU’s presence and growing community in the UK.
Held annually since 2013, the EdTechX Awards are among the most influential accolades in the educational technology sector, spotlighting companies that demonstrate sustained growth, transformative innovation, and measurable impact. The finalists and winners are widely regarded as key drivers of global change in education.

IU Group (IUG) is one of the largest university groups in Europe, providing personalised higher education with innovative EdTech solutions. IUG offers a diversified mix of online degree courses, part-time studies and on-campus learning. It is at the forefront of leveraging technology and innovation to meet the changing needs of students around the world. IUG’s vertically integrated education platform offers the largest portfolio of bachelor’s and master’s degree programmes in Europe with more than 250 accredited courses and some 500 upskilling offerings in German and English. IU Group cooperates with more than 15,000 enterprises and actively supporting them in their people development including in high-demand areas such as business administration, data & artificial intelligence and technology. The company was founded in 2021 and is the proprietor of several universities – IU International University of Applied Sciences in Germany with 38 campuses nationwide, the Walbrook Institute London (formerly LIBF) in the UK, as well as the University of Fredericton (UFred) in Canada – all together counting more than 140,000 students. Behind IU Group are more than 4,000 employees from nearly 90 nationalities. Further information at: iu-group.com.
